Calculation

To perform this calculation, we used the following formula:

Total hours = Minutes / Minutes in an hour

Where the number of minutes is 123, and the number of minutes in an hour is 60. By plugging these values into the formula, we obtained the following result:

Total hours = 123 / 60 = 2.05

This means that there are currently 2.05 hours represented by the 123 minutes. To convert this into a more accessible format, we can also express this as 2 hours and 3 minutes.
